A heart-warming, inclusive and funny new story about three big F's: friends, following your dreams and football!


Hi! I'm Charligh, and one day I'm going to be a big star. I'm full of PIZZAZZ after all, and everyone I've ever met tells me I'm unforgettable. In a good way, I think . . .

I've always loved attention, but at the moment, there's a teeny tiny chance I'm getting it for all the wrong reasons.

For starters, me and my very-nearly-world-famous team, the Bramrock Stars, are trying to win big against our rivals in the new league. But I can't stop tripping over the ball!

And although I've got my dream part in the school play, the words just won't stick in my head. What's going to happen if I can't learn my lines?

Luckily for me, my best friends really are the bestest, and I know they'll help me whatever it takes. It's time for me to step into the spotlight, and prove girls really can do anything!
